Harry Coulson and his Rain Dogs are to stop in for two gigs in Sydney early next month as they make their way around New South Wales and Victoria.

Who let the rain dogs out? Oh, Harry Coulson did. Coulson is a young (he just graduated from uni) Melbourne-based guitarist who performs a delicate mix of jazz and blues. Of course, having attended New York University’s jazz summer workshops, it is no surprise that Coulson (as well as his Rain Dogs) display fantastic musicianship.

The Coulson-fronted trio (comprising Louis Gill on bass and James Thompson on drums) are touring ostensibly in support of their self-titled debut album, which you can listen to below:

Harry Coulson’s Rain Dogs are playing by themselves at Mr. Falcon’s (for free!) on Friday April 3, and with the Peter Koopman Trio at Foundry616 on Tuesday April 7.
